About agriculture in Barcarrota

Barcarrota is a picturesque town situated in the province of Badajoz, within the autonomous community of Extremadura in southwestern Spain. The surrounding landscape is dominated by the characteristic dehesa, a unique agro-silvo-pastoral ecosystem featuring rolling hills, vast meadows, and scattered holm and cork oaks that provide shelter for livestock.

The local agricultural economy is deeply rooted in this Mediterranean environment. The land is primarily utilized for extensive livestock farming, particularly the raising of Iberian pigs that graze freely among the oaks. In addition to livestock, the region supports traditional dryland farming, with significant cultivation of olives, cereals, and vineyards that benefit from the temperate climate.
